Notice of Pre-AIA or AIA Status 1. The present application, filed on or after March 16, 2013, is being examined under the first inventor to file provisions of the AIA . Claim Rejections - 35 USC § 101 2. 35 U.S.C. 101 reads as follows: Whoever invents or discovers any new and useful process, machine, manufacture, or composition of matter, or any new and useful improvement thereof, may obtain a patent therefor, subject to the conditions and requirements of this title. 3. Claims 1-20 are rejected under 35 U.S.C. §101 because the claimed invention recites and is directed to a judicial exception to patentability (i.e., a law of nature, a natural phenomenon, or an abstract idea) and does not include an inventive concept that is “significantly more” than the judicial exception under the January 2019 and October 2019 patentable subject matter eligibility guidance (2019 PEG) analysis which follows. Step 1 4. Under the 2019 PEG step 1 analysis, it must first be determined whether the claims are directed to one of the four statutory categories of invention (i.e., process, machine, manufacture, or composition of matter). Applying step 1 of the analysis for patentable subject matter to the claims, it is determined that the claims are directed to the statutory category of a process (claims 1-10) and a machine (claims 11-20). Therefore, we proceed to step 2A, Prong 1. Step 2A, Prong 1 5. Under the 2019 PEG step 2A, Prong 1 analysis, it must be determined whether the claims recite an abstract idea that falls within one or more designated categories of patent ineligible subject matter (i.e., organizing human activity, mathematical concepts, and mental processes) that amount to a judicial exception to patentability. Claim 1 recites the abstract idea of: A method comprising: receiving, from [[a conversation simulator running on a mobile client device and at an artificial intelligence engine]], a first conversational response from a user of [[the mobile client device]] regarding an action to be taken; making a first determination regarding the action to be taken based on a context of [[the artificial intelligence engine]]; receiving, at [[the artificial intelligence engine and from the conversation simulator running on the mobile client device]], a second conversational response from the user of [[the mobile client device]] regarding the action to be taken; adding the conversational response from the user to the context of [[the artificial intelligence engine]] to create a first updated context; making a second determination regarding the action based on the first updated context; communicating with [[a third-party system]] through a series of one or more messages to complete the action based on the second determination; determining that the action is associated with an existing record; determining a first purpose for the action based on the first updated context; proposing the first purpose for the action to the user [[via the conversation simulator]]; receiving a purpose response that the first purpose is incorrect [[via the conversation simulator]]; adding the purpose response to the first updated context to form a second updated context; determining a second purpose for the action based on the second updated context; proposing the second purpose for the action to the user [[via the conversation simulator]]; receiving an affirmative response that the second purpose is correct [[via the conversation simulator]; updating the existing record to include the second purpose; determining an event associated with the action based on the context; determining that the action satisfies a policy based on the context; creating a record associating the second updated context and the action; and mapping the action to the event within a report associated with the event. Here, the recited abstract idea falls within one or more of the three enumerated 2019 PEG categories of patent ineligible subject matter, to wit: certain methods of organizing human activity, which includes fundamental economic practices or principles and/or commercial interactions (e.g., facilitating an interaction with a user regarding a transaction). Step 2A, Prong 2 6. Under the 2019 PEG step 2A, Prong 2 analysis, the identified abstract idea to which claim 1 is directed does not include limitations or additional elements that integrate the abstract idea into a practical application. Besides reciting the abstract idea, the limitations of claim 1 also recite generic computer components (e.g., a conversation simulator running on a mobile client device and at an artificial intelligence engine, and a third-party system). In particular, the recited features of the abstract idea are merely being applied on a computer or computing device or via software programming that is simply being used as a tool (“apply it”) to implement the abstract idea. (See e.g., MPEP §2106.05(f)). Therefore, these additional elements are recited at a high level of generality such that they amount to no more than mere instructions to apply the exception using generic computer components. In other words, the additional elements are simply used as tools to perform the abstract idea. Claim 1 also recites the following limitation: presenting the first determination to the user via the conversation simulator. This limitation merely states that the system outputs/presents the first determination to the user. However, the claim does not provide significant technical detail regarding how the first determination is displayed. Therefore, this limitation amounts to no more than merely outputting/displaying data, which is a form of insignificant extra-solution activity (See MPEP 2016.05(g): OIP Techs., Inc. v. Amazon.com, Inc., 788 F.3d 1359, 1363 (Fed. Cir. 2015)). Thus, claim 1 does not include any limitations or additional elements that integrate the abstract idea into a practical application. As a result, claim 1 is directed to an abstract idea. Step 2B 7. Under the 2019 PEG step 2B analysis, the additional elements of claim 1 are evaluated to determine whether they amount to something “significantly more” than the recited abstract idea. (i.e., an innovative concept). Here, the recited additional elements (e.g., a conversation simulator running on a mobile client device and at an artificial intelligence engine, and a third-party system), do not amount to an innovative concept since, as stated above in the Step 2A, Prong 2 analysis, the claims are simply using the additional elements as a tool to carry out the abstract idea (i.e., “apply it”) on a computer or computing device and/or via software programming (See e.g., MPEP §2106.05(f)). The additional elements are specified at a high level of generality such that they are being used in the claims to simply implement the abstract idea and are not themselves being technologically improved (See e.g., MPEP 2106.05(I)(A)). Additionally, the following limitation identified above as insignificant extra-solution activity (merely outputting/displaying data) has been revaluated in Step 2B: presenting the first determination to the user via the conversation simulator. As stated in MPEP 2106.05(d), a factual determination is required to support a conclusion that an additional element (or combination of additional elements) is well-understood, routine, conventional activity (Berkheimer v. HP, Inc., 881 F.3d 1360, 1368 (Fed. Cir. 2018)). In view of this requirement set forth by Berkheimer, this limitation does not integrate the abstract idea into a practical application, or amount to significantly more than the abstract idea, because the courts have found the concept of merely outputting/displaying data to be well-understood, routine, and conventional activity (See MPEP 2106.05(d): OIP Techs., Inc., v. Amazon.com, Inc., 788 F.3d 1359, 1363 (Fed. Cir. 2015)). Thus, claim 1 does not recite any additional elements that amount to “significantly more” than the abstract idea. Additional Independent Claims 8. Independent claim 11 is similarly rejected under 35 U.S.C. 101 for the reasons described below: Claim 11 recites limitations that are substantially similar to those recited in claim 1. However, the primary difference between claims 11 and 1 is that claim 11 is drafted as a system rather than as a method. Similarly, as described above regarding claim 1, claim 11 recites generic computer components (e.g., an assistant server running a logic layer providing an artificial intelligence engine, conversation simulator, a mobile client device, and a third-party system) that are simply being used as a tool (“apply it”) to implement the abstract idea. Therefore, since the same analysis should be used for claims 1 and 11, claim 11 is not patent eligible (See Alice Corp. Pty. Ltd. V. CLS Bank Int’l, 134 S. Ct. 2347, 2354 (2014)). Dependent Claims 9. Dependent claims 2-10 and 12-20 are also rejected under 35 U.S.C. 101 for the reasons described below: Claims 2, 3, 15, and 16 simply further refine the abstract idea because they recite process steps (e.g., sending contact information including one or more accounts associated with the user, and communicating with the third party using the contact information) that fall under the category of organizing human activity, as described above regarding claim 1. Additionally, merely stating that messages are “encoded” and “decoded” does not integrate the abstract idea into a practical application. The claims do not provide any technical detail regarding how the messages are encoded/decoded. Therefore, such limitations amount to no more than merely applying generic encoding/decoding technology to implement the abstract idea on a computer. Claims 4 and 17 simply further refine the abstract idea because they recite process steps (e.g., selecting an action option and communicating the selection to the third-party) that fall under the category of organizing human activity, as described above regarding claim 1. Claims 5, 6, 12, and 13 simply further refine the abstract idea because they recite process steps (e.g., selecting a component to facilitate performance of the action) that fall under the category of organizing human activity, as described above regarding claim 1. Additionally, simply stating that that the components include a conversation simulator, an enterprise system having enterprise data, and an action management system amount to no more than merely applying generic computer components to implement the abstract idea on a computer. Claims 7 and 14 simply provide further definition to the process of selecting a component for facilitating the action option recited in claims 5 and 13. Simply stating that the process is based on a level of sensitivity of information that needs to be provided to facilitate performance of the action does not provide an indication of an improvement to any technology or technological field. Rather, this merely defines the conditions under which a particular component may be selected. Claims 8, 9, 18, and 19 simply provide further definition to the “context” recited in claims 1 and 11. Simply stating that the context includes enterprise data including one of email entries, calendar entries, and customer relationship management data does not provide an indication of an improvement to any technology or technological field. Rather, this merely defines the conditions under which a particular component may be selected. Claims 10 and 20 simply recite process steps for generating a training data set and training a machine learning model using the training data set. However, the claims do not provide significant technical detail regarding how the dataset is generated and/or how the machine learning model is trained. Therefore, such limitations amount to no more than merely applying generic machine learning technology to implement the abstract idea on a computer. Thus, the dependent claims do not add any additional element or subject matter that provides a technological improvement (i.e., an integration into a practical application) that results in the claims being directed to patent eligible subject matter or include an element or feature that is significantly more than the recited abstract idea (i.e., a technological inventive concept under Step 2B). Citation of Pertinent Prior Art 10. The prior art made of record and not relied upon is considered pertinent to applicant's disclosure: McGann (U.S. Pre-Grant Publication No. 20160189558): The prior art reference which is most closely related to the claims of the instant application is McGann. McGann discloses a process for simulating an interaction between a customer and an agent of a customer contact center. The simulation may help the agent better determine the intent of the interaction and assess a confidence of its deduction prior to engaging in the interaction. However, McGann does not disclose the specific series of process steps recited in the independent claims of the instant application. Bansal (U.S. Pre-Grant Publication No. 20030120593): Bansal discloses a system that is capable of delivering multiple services to various users involved in the processing of credit card transactions. Kornblit (U.S. Pre-Grant Publication No. 20190354557): Kornblit discloses a fully automated intelligent system and method for interactive online communication. The system receives and analyzes a customer query, and provides an answer to the customer. The system learns on an ongoing basis by requesting assistance from live agents when it is not confident about an answer to the query, and then training itself with that new answer. Wu (U.S. Patent No. 10733496): Wu discloses a system and method for providing a conversation session with an artificial intelligence entity in a user interface. Walia (U.S. Patent No. 10579834): Walia discloses systems and method that generally relate to natural language customer interactions with customer support representatives of an enterprise, and more particularly to a method and apparatus for facilitating customer intent prediction from natural language interactions of customers for improving customer interaction experiences.
